How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mckenzie County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mckenzie County Studio Apartments | $962 | $775 | $1,025 |
| Mckenzie County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,064 | $895 | $1,550 |
| Mckenzie County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,286 | $1,095 | $1,575 |
| Mckenzie County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,497 | $1,300 | $1,775 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Mckenzie County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Mckenzie County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Mckenzie County is $1,286.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Mckenzie County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Mckenzie County is a 1,115 square feet unit starting from $1,125 at Madison Heights Apartments.
What is the average size for Mckenzie County 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Mckenzie County is currently 973 sq ft.
